About The Position

The Guest Services team is responsible for luggage assistance and valet, but most importantly, is our guests’ first welcome and last farewell. Guest Services Manager, reporting to the Director of Rooms, is responsible for ensuring an excellent guest experience and managing the Guest Services Team.

Responsibilities

  • Uphold the highest standard of customer service by demonstrating and applying Forbes 5 Star service standards at all times.
  • Lead and manage all aspects of the Guest Services Team (Door, Bell and Valet) and ensure all service standards are followed with friendly and engaging service
  • Participating in interviewing, recruiting and selection of new team members
  • Liaise with VIP parties, ensuring that transportation is in order and greeting and escorting as needed throughout stay
  • Thorough knowledge of emergency procedures (Emergency Preparedness Manual) and general crisis situation procedures
  • Act as property champion for valet parking system and coordinate with external parking contacts
  • Liaise with other departments to ensure smooth guest arrival and departure experience
  • Respond to both employee and guest issues promptly, completing follow up and taking corrective action as required
  • Develop and implement arrival and departure SOP’s, fostering a service oriented culture.
  • Coordinate the training, operations, and success of the valet department
  • Complete workforce planning including scheduling and working with Rooms Division Coordinator to ensure Dayforce accuracy
